Automatically creates and caches relatively efficient binary representations of XML files. */ #ifndef INCLUDED_XEROMYCES #define INCLUDED_XEROMYCES #include "ps/Errors.h" ERROR_GROUP(Xeromyces); ERROR_TYPE(Xeromyces, XMLOpenFailed); ERROR_TYPE(Xeromyces, XMLParseError); #include "XeroXMB.h" #include "lib/file/vfs/vfs.h" class RelaxNGValidator; class WriteBuffer; typedef struct _xmlDoc xmlDoc; typedef xmlDoc* xmlDocPtr; class CXeromyces : public XMBFile { friend class TestXeroXMB; public: /** * Load from an XML file (with invisible XMB caching). */ PSRETURN Load(const PIVFS& vfs, const VfsPath& filename, const std::string& validatorName = ""); /** * Load from an in-memory XML string (with no caching). */ PSRETURN LoadString(const char* xml, const std::string& validatorName = ""); /** * Convert the given XML file into an XMB in the archive cache. * Returns the XMB path in @p archiveCachePath. * Returns false on error. */ bool GenerateCachedXMB(const PIVFS& vfs, const VfsPath& sourcePath, VfsPath& archiveCachePath, const std::string& validatorName = ""); /** * Call once when initialising the program, to load libxml2. * This should be run in the main thread, before any thread uses libxml2. */ static void Startup(); /** * Call once when shutting down the program, to unload libxml2. */ static void Terminate(); static bool AddValidator(const PIVFS& vfs, const std::string& name, const VfsPath& grammarPath); static bool ValidateEncoded(const std::string& name, const std::wstring& filename, const std::string& document); private: static RelaxNGValidator& GetValidator(const std::string& name); PSRETURN ConvertFile(const PIVFS& vfs, const VfsPath& filename, const VfsPath& xmbPath, const std::string& validatorName); bool ReadXMBFile(const PIVFS& vfs, const VfsPath& filename); static PSRETURN CreateXMB(const xmlDocPtr doc, WriteBuffer& writeBuffer); shared_ptr m_XMBBuffer; }; #define _XERO_MAKE_UID2__(p,l) p ## l #define _XERO_MAKE_UID1__(p,l) _XERO_MAKE_UID2__(p,l) #define _XERO_CHILDREN _XERO_MAKE_UID1__(_children_, __LINE__) #define _XERO_I _XERO_MAKE_UID1__(_i_, __LINE__) #define XERO_ITER_EL(parent_element, child_element) \ for (XMBElement child_element : parent_element.GetChildNodes()) #define XERO_ITER_ATTR(parent_element, attribute) \ for (XMBAttribute attribute : parent_element.GetAttributes()) #endif // INCLUDED_XEROMYCES
